WebTo remove untracked files using -f flag with git clean command: git clean -f. To remove untracked files inside a subfolder use: git clean -f folderpath. The untracked files will now be deleted. If you want to delete untracked folders too, you can use the -d flag: git clean -fd. WebMay 24, 2024 · 1. After you git reset --hard, you need to run git clean in order to remove untracked files. These files are deleted from the drive. If you want to reset your directory completely, run git clean -dfx. If you want to be more selective, try running git clean -dfxi or messing with the parameters as you see fit. Share. Now, run: git clean -n. The result is this: Would remove file.txt. This time, if you use git status or ls/dir, you’ll see the file remains there.

WebMar 23, 2009 · git reset --hard To remove untracked files, I usually just delete all files in the working copy (but not the .git/ folder!), then do git reset --hard which leaves it with only committed files. A better way is to use git clean (warning: using the -x flag as below will cause Git to delete ignored files): git clean -d -x -f

Webgit rm --cached does not unstage a file, it actually stages the removal of the file(s) from the repo (assuming it was already committed before) but leaves the file in your working tree (leaving you with an untracked file). git reset -- will unstage any staged changes for the given file(s).
